Creates and maintains programs for the Flying Probe and ICT with
primary focus on Flying Probe.
Responsible for qualification of test processes, such as,
acceptance test, test coverage and other equipment test. (includes
test infrastructure)
Liaises with test fixture/software vendors and customers for all
test processes and peripherals
Responsible for directing, supporting, analyses, and failure
diagnoses for product, equipment and software (either this position
completes the work, or it interfaces with technicians to complete
the work.)
Develops and produces various reports for internal and external use
on an as needed basis
Develops DFT test coverage reports for both internal and external
use
Quality and continuous improvement for test processes; includes
ISO, documentation, test optimization and test equipment
qualifications if required
Liaises with customer representatives as directed on test related
issues on customer designs
Supports product and process root cause analysis
Performs with minimum supervision and technical assistance while
maintaining strict adherence to quality standards
Responsible for test time calculations and NRE requirements
Supports lean/continuous improvement philosophies regarding
preventive actions and department operation
Prepares activity reports and other data input as required
Other miscellaneous tasks as assigned
These tasks are performed in accordance with engineering
instructions, company standard operating procedures, professional
training, customer requirements, and individual experience.
Qualifications Required/Job Specifications:
Seven (7) years of Test Engineering experience in a contract
manufacturing environment of PCBA and mechanical assemblies
Fluent with program generation on Keysight i3070 ICT, Takaya
9411/1400/1600.
Fluent with ICT fixture design, establishing specifications and
interacting with 3rd party fixture builders.
Experience with the implementation of Boundary Scan in the ICT
environment
Solid decision-making skills.
Possess conflict resolution skills and the ability to apply
techniques at all levels of the organization
Possess a high level of integrity in handling confidential and
sensitive information
Possess a Bachelor's degree, formal training on the aforementioned
ATE, or equivalent experience.
Ability to use common sense to solve practical problems.
Utilizes oscilloscopes and other test equipment to generate test
programs and diagnose and debug circuits
Familiar with and utilizes precision measuring devices and
electronic equipment to ensure compliance of parts and products
with established standards and specifications
